Join us in making homes safer and communities stronger.

At Bromford Flagship, we believe everyone deserves a safe, affordable home. With over 80,000 homes across east, central, and southwest England, we’re committed to building a better future. We’re now looking for an experienced Asbestos Removal Project Manager / Surveyor to join our Compliance team and help us deliver safe, compliant, and customer-focused asbestos remediation projects.

We are recruiting for two roles – one based in our South Gloucestershire and Gloucestershire region (covering areas such as Bristol and Gloucestershire), and one in our West Midlands region (covering Wolverhampton, Lichfield, and surrounding Central areas).

What you’ll be doing:

  • Managing licensed and non-licensed asbestos removal projects across occupied homes, communal areas, and offices.
  • Coordinating with internal teams, contractors, and customers to ensure smooth project delivery with minimal disruption.
  • Ensuring full compliance with the Control of Asbestos Regulations 2012, HSG 247, HSG 248, and other relevant standards.
  • Overseeing contractor performance, budgets, documentation, and health & safety on-site.
  • Building strong relationships with stakeholders and providing regular updates to senior leaders.

What we’re looking for:

  • Proven experience managing asbestos removal projects in the housing sector.
  • BOHS P402 and P405 qualifications (or equivalent).
  • Strong understanding of social housing, customer communication, and safeguarding.
  • Excellent organisational, communication, and ICT skills.
  • A full UK driving licence and access to a vehicle.
  • SMSTS/SSSTS and NEBOSH General Certificate.
  • Experience with D365 or similar asset management platforms.
